Robotic Tower Welding Line Approaches
The demand for cost-effective wind tower manufacturing is pushing a significant shift towards robotic welding lines . These solutions typically involve integrated robots capable of performing intricate welds on substantial wind blade components. Benefits include reduced labor requirements, enhanced weld consistency , and higher output speeds. Furthermore, advanced vision technologies and precision testing methodologies are commonly integrated to guarantee structural stability Wind Tower Welding Line Manufacturer and longevity.
Breeze Tower Fabrication Line Layout and Assembly
The optimized planning and subsequent production of a wind tower fabrication line necessitates a careful assessment of multiple factors . Automation play a critical role in achieving consistent accuracy and reducing expenses. A typical line includes numerous stations, each assigned to a defined operation , such as bevel preparation , root weld , and subsequent sections. Manufacturing oversight systems are included to confirm conformity to strict quality specifications .
